Moweo — Lucas 2 i 1

White children´s high chair with removable tray and bar. The product is also sold online.

Hazard
The product has only a crotch restraint on the belt, not between the seat and the tray/bar. Consequently, if the belt is not used, the child might slip through the opening between the tray/bar and fall, resulting in injuries, or become trapped with the chest, head or neck between the tray and the seat, resulting in suffocation or strangulation.
